Exelos partner TrendMicro recently published a good article explaining several common backdoor techniques and the role of backdoors in targeted attacks. Backdoors are applications that open up computers to remote access. Unprotected networked computers can give attackers opportunities to issue silent commands to infected computers, allowing them to spy on online conversations, access infected sites, and steal passwords.
